Sails, Staunton Harold – Original Painting
From a Viewpoint — a collection born from the landscape encountered on foot, where each painting is a record of a moment, a place, and the quiet pull of nature.
This piece was painted from one of my local walks around Staunton Harold Reservoir. I'm always drawn to where land meets the water's edge; I love the way the colours shift, the reflections blur, and the stillness is punctuated by movement.
Here I've tried to capture the little dinghies, their white sails cutting through the layers of blues and greens, animated against the rolling landscape beyond, creating that sense of gentle motion: the sway of a sail, the ripple of water, the energy of a breezy afternoon on the water.
An original acrylic art work, painted with expressive, gestural brushwork in a palette of aqua, cobalt, violet, and earthy green — a piece that brings the feeling of open air and open water into your home.
